在数学逻辑的世界里,有一种神奇的规则,它能够帮助我们简化复杂的逻辑表达式,这就是著名的摩根定理。摩根定理是逻辑学中的一个重要原理,它揭示了否定在逻辑运算中的反变性质。通过理解和应用摩根定理,我们可以更轻松地解决各种逻辑问题。
什么是摩根定理?
摩根定理主要有两个部分:
德·摩根定律(De Morgan’s Laws):它说明了逻辑运算中否定与合取(AND)和析取(OR)之间的关系。具体来说,非A与非B的合取等价于A或B的否定,反之亦然。
- 用逻辑符号表示为:
- 非A AND 非B ≡ 非A OR 非B
- 非A OR 非B ≡ 非A AND 非B
- 用逻辑符号表示为:
摩根定律的逆定理:它说明了合取的否定与析取的关系,以及析取的否定与合取的关系。
- 用逻辑符号表示为:
- 非A AND B ≡ 非A OR 非B
- 非A OR B ≡ 非A AND 非B
- 用逻辑符号表示为:
摩根定理的应用
摩根定理在逻辑电路设计、计算机科学、数学证明等多个领域都有广泛的应用。以下是一些具体的例子:
1. 逻辑电路设计
在数字电路中,摩根定理可以帮助我们简化逻辑门的设计。例如,一个需要实现非A AND 非B的逻辑电路,可以通过应用摩根定理设计成一个A OR B的逻辑电路。
2. 编程语言
在编程语言中,摩根定理可以用来简化条件判断。例如,在Python中,可以使用摩根定理来将一个复杂的条件判断简化为一个更简单的形式。
# 原始的条件判断
if not (a and b):
# ...
# 使用摩根定理简化后的条件判断
if not a or not b:
# ...
3. 数学证明
在数学证明中,摩根定理可以用来证明一些看似复杂的逻辑等价式。例如,证明非A OR 非B等价于非A AND 非B。
如何应用摩根定理?
要应用摩根定理,我们需要遵循以下步骤:
识别出逻辑表达式中的否定:首先,我们需要识别出表达式中是否含有否定操作。
应用摩根定理:根据摩根定理,将否定操作应用于合取或析取。
简化表达式:通过应用摩根定理,我们可以简化复杂的逻辑表达式。
总结
摩根定理是数学逻辑中的一个强大工具,它可以帮助我们简化复杂的逻辑问题。通过理解和应用摩根定理,我们可以更好地理解逻辑运算的原理,并在各种领域中使用它来解决问题。
